On August 31, 1999, nVIDIA announced the integrATion of hardware T&L (Transform and Lighting) into the graphics core, the first GeForce (Geometry Force) product-GeForce 256 graphics card, which pioneered the concept of GPU (Graphics Processing Unit). The GPU originally referred to display chips that support hardware T&L, but today, all display chips are collectively referred to as GPUs.
The GeForce 256 graphics card uses the T&L engine to share the processor computing load. For video games that support the T&L engine, the performance of the GeForce 256 can be fully utilized, bringing a revolution in 3D graphics performance.In fact, Geforce 256 won the title of "The world's first GPU" is very difficult, because there are two opponents in front of it.

May 11, 1999 ,3Dlabs announced the Oxygen GVX1, workstation graphics card.The GVX1 does not take nVIDIA's more cost-effective route of integrating hardware T&L support into the core.this using GLINT R3(Permedia 3) and one external chip ,this chip is GLINT Gamma G1, Geometry Processor.The GLINT Gamma G1 is capable of processing 4.75 million triangles per second.Although Oxygen GVX1 is a hardware T & L graphics card before Geforce 256, but they were not integrated into the graphics core.

The gaming performance of Oxygen GVX1 is only slightly better than TNT, and the professional 3D performance is only about half of Quadro 256. It is not difficult to understand why 3Dlabs has stopped selling chips since Permedia 3, and focused on mid-to-high-end professional graphic cards. As a result, 3Dlabs has missed a large number of entry-level professional graphics card users who can do professional work and meet general entertainment needs. Even if 3Dlabs acquired Intense3D in July 2000 and released the Wildcat II Series graphics card, it still could not escape the fate of being acquired by Creative Technology in June 2002.

The strongest rival of GeForce 256 is undoubtedly Savage 2000, which was announced by S3 the day before. S3 had high hopes for Savage 2000. On June 22, 1999, it made a desperate acquisition of Diamond, turning a chip manufacturer into a graphics card manufacturer. In November, it released the Viper II Z200 graphics card based on the Savage 2000 chip.

Savage 2000 hardware supports S3TL similar to hardware T&L, but the initial driver is based on DirectX 6 (DirectX 7 is the first version to support hardware T&L), resulting in S3TL not working at all and it is not a real GPU. The 3D performance is only 80% of the GeForce 256 graphics card, so S3 lost the title of "The world's first GPU". The miserable ending was acquired by VIA on August 5, 2000, and it exited the GPU competition early.

On the same day that nVIDIA announced the GeForce 256 graphics card, Videologic announced that the only Neon 250 graphics card using the PowerVR 250 chip will be sold in the UK.PowerVR 250 (PowerVR second generation) is a PC ported version of the Sega game console version PVR250DC jointly launched by Videologic and NEC on December 2, 1998.Compared with PVR250DC, the performance of PowerVR 250 has shrunk a lot, and the performance is still close to TNT2.This is because the PowerVR 250 display chip integrates unique TBR technology, which effectively reduces the burden on the CPU, but it is much inferior to the Geforce 256 graphics card that supports T&L with hardware.

The GeForce 256 graphics card is too powerful, and even the Rage Fury Maxx graphics card with dual RAGE 128 Pro cores on November 7, 1999 could not be matched by ATi. Rage Fury Maxx graphics cards are priced higher than GeForce 256 graphics cards, and their 3D performance is only about 80%, which is slightly weaker than Savage 2000 graphics cards.

Even the well-known 3dfx Voodoo3 graphics card (April 3, 1999) in the same period can hardly conceal its brilliance, and the 3D performance is only about 70% of the GeForce 256 graphics card. In 1999, nVIDIA surpassed 3dfx for the first time with a shipment of 10 million pieces.

Since then, nVIDIA's Geforce series has established GPU dominance in one fell swoop, gradually letting out competitors one by one.
GeForce 256 series products include GeForce 256 and GeForce 256 DDR. The professional version is called Quadro and is based on GeForce 256.

The GeForce 256 core has four rendering pipelines, each of which includes four pixel units, a material unit, and provides two different graphics memory configurATion options, SDRAM and DDR SDRAM. The GeForce 256 chip supports DirectX 7.0, T&L, and OpenGL 1.2 at the same time. And other advanced graphics technology. It became the product with the longest life cycle at that time.

In the article "History of nVIDIA Graphics cards Vol. 1", the PCB Code of nVIDIA's engineering sample graphics cards are: S/N EVAL-???- (note: EvaluATion board), S/N BRD-???- (note : Reference board).
Entering the Geforce era, nVIDIA’s engineering sample graphics cards began to cancel the “S/N” label, and enable PCB Code starting with “180”. Commonly used are reference boards with the letter “P” in the PCB Code, and evaluATion boards with the letter “E” are rare. , The letter "A" is the Apple MAC version. The number of engineering samples with the letter "T" in the PCB Code was the least, and only one Geforce FX5800 graphics card was found.

On November 1, 1999 (9945 week), nVIDIA announced the workstATion GPU Quadro. The Quadro core clock is 135MHz, which is an increase of 15MHz over Geforce's 120MHz core clock. The higher core clock increases Quadro's fill rate by 13% to 540 Mpixels/s.

On April 25, 2000, half a year after the introduction of GeForce 256, ATi launched the first generation of faster and more efficient GPU-Radeon 256 (R100 series).

Even the GeForce2 GTS announced by nVIDIA the next day could only be evenly matched. Later, the GeForce2 GTS relied on the Detonator III driver to successfully counterattack. The architecture of the GeForce2 GTS is similar to that of the previous GeForce 256, with the addition of a second TMU. Due to the use of a more advanced 180nm process, the core frequency has almost doubled (to 200Mhz). However, the video memory bandwidth is slightly insufficient, and the performance of Direct3D games is not as good as OpenGL.

On June 5, 2000, Imagination Technologies, which spun off from VideoLogic, announced that Kyro (the third generation of PowerVR) was manufactured by its strategic partner ST Microelectronics. Kyro core codenamed STG 4000X, adopts 0.25 micron technology, 12 million transistors, display core and video memory are both 125Mhz, 128bit 32/64MB SDRAM video memory. The unique TBR technology is difficult to overcome the weakness of not supporting hardware T&L, and the flaws of the dual-pipeline single-texture unit cause the performance to be inferior to the GeForce 256, let alone the GeForce2 GTS of the same period. However, Kyro's core size is small, heat generation is small, and the number of transistors is also significantly lower than that of nVidia's products at the same time, which has a higher cost performance. In addition, ST Microelectronics has led many manufacturers such as Hercules to join, and graphics cards based on Kyro chips have finally taken a place in the market.

On June 22, 2000, 3dfx released the Voodoo5 5500 graphics card with dual VSA-100 chips, which was comparable in performance to GeForce2 GTS.

3dfx knows that the VSA-100 chip does not support hardware T&L and cannot compete with contemporary GPUs, so it has no choice but to adopt a multi-core solution. The actual performance of the Voodoo5 6000 graphics card with four VSA-100 chips is only comparable to that of GeForce2 Ultra. The efficiency is low, the design is difficult, and it takes nearly a year to still be in the engineering sample stage, and it also seriously affects the development of the Rampage graphics card that supports hardware T&L. As a result, 3dfx was acquired by nVIDIA on December 15, 2000, prematurely exiting the GPU hegemony. The Voodoo5 6000 graphics card is undoubtedly the craziest design in history, and it is worthy of being a classic handed down. Especially the tragic color of the ups and downs, only 84 survived and became the bellwether of the graphics card collection.

On December 11, 2000, SiS released the first-generation GPU graphics card SiS315. Because it provides 3D acceleration performance equivalent to GeForce2 MX at a relatively low price, and has excellent video playback effects, it has also achieved a small amount of market sales.

The GeForce2 series products are mainly divided into the high-end GeForce2 GTS/GeForce2 Ultra, the low-end GeForce 2 MX series and the first mobile GeForce2 GO series. Starting from this generation, the GeForce series has been divided into a variety of models with a clearer level ladder, so as to better meet the consumer groups at all levels. GeForce2 is also the first nVIDIA series to support multiple display configurations. The GeForce2 series of professional editions have Quadro2 PRO based on GeForce2 GTS and Quadro2 MXR based on GeForce2 MX, as well as the mobile version of the first generation GPU--Quadro2 Go.

2.9 nFroce

At the beginning of 1996, SiS launched the SiS5596 chipset with built-in graphics accelerator and VGA controller. This is the earliest integrated graphics chip for desktop computers; on February 20, 1997, Cyrix launched the IT industry’s first chip integration solution (All in One). Media GX chip, in addition to integrating S3 ViRGE/DX, it also integrates Cyrix Cx5x86 CPU and audio; on November 21, 1998, VIA announced the launch of the Apollo MVP4 chipset integrated with Triden Blande 3D; on April 26, 1999, Intel released the integrated i740 display core The i810 chipset has achieved unprecedented success in the market and has made a great contribution to the popularization of integrated chipsets; on November 8, 1999, ALi announced the launch of Aladdin 7 chipsets with integrated ArtX video chips.

Motherboard integrated display already has a large market. As the GPU overlord, nVIDIA is naturally unwilling to be lonely. On Computex2001 on June 4, 2001, nVIDIA released the first-generation motherboard chipset nForce, code-named Crush 12. The nForce chipset is composed of the north bridge chip IGP (Integrated Graphics Processor) and the south bridge chip MCP (Media and Communications Processor) that integrate GeForce2 MX.

nVIDIA involves the field of motherboard chipsets, starting with the XBOX project in cooperation with Microsoft. February 14, 2001-nVIDIA released the graphics processing unit (XGPU) and media communication processor (MCPX) for the Xbox video game console. Taking this opportunity, nVIDIA uses many advanced technologies from the XBOX project to develop its first PC chipset product-nForce. Seeing that nVIDIA launched the nForce series, ATi also released the integrated graphics chip Radeon IGP in 2002, which is equivalent to the level of Radeon VE.

3. GeForce 3(NV20) series

In view of the progress made by the GeForce2 series, nVIDIA released the first GeForce3 graphics card supporting DirectX 8 on February 27, 2001. In terms of hardware specifications, GeForce3 does not have a big gap with GeForce2 GTS, and all the advantages are now in DirectX 8's advanced API technology. In addition, GeForce3 supports a programmable T&L engine and is the industry's first programmable GPU.

On March 12, 2001, Kyro II was launched. The core code is STG4500. It adopts 0.18 micron process, 15 million transistors, core and video memory frequency is increased to 175Mhz, 128bit 32/64MB SDRAM video memory, dual pipeline single texture unit. Although Kyro II was known as the MX400 killer in the European market at the time, its performance was weaker than GeForce2 GTS and only half of its rival GeForce3 in the same period. The problem with Kyro II is that the rendering pipeline is too small, the fill rate is limited, and the video memory bandwidth provided by the outdated SDR video memory limits the performance. What is particularly serious is that Kyro II still fails to support hardware T&L, and relying on a part of software T&L to try to gain a foothold in the GPU competition has become an impossible task.

On June 18, 2001, Trident released the first-generation GPU: Blade XP. The performance was so weak that it was only equivalent to the TNT2 level, and was eventually ignored by the market. The mobile version of Blade XP is called Cyberblade XP.

On August 14, 2001, ATi launched Radeon 8500 (R200 series). In its battle with GeForce3 Ti500, even if the Radeon 8500 graphics card has a higher theoretical performance, the GeForce3 Ti500 still has a great advantage thanks to the excellent support of the detonator driver.

nVIDIA returned to the home gaming console market again in 2001, becoming an important part of Microsoft's original Xbox. The onboard graphics card comes from nVIDIA's NV2A, which is an adjusted GeForce3 with performance close to that of GeForce3 Ti500.
The three models of the GeForce3 series products are all mid-to-high-end, and there is no low-end series and mobile platform series. The professional version is called Quadro DCC.

4. GeForce 4(NV25)系列


The successor to GeForce3 was released on February 6, 2002 and was called GeForce4 Ti. Its architecture is similar to NV20 (GeForce3), but NV25 is significantly faster due to its 150nm process. By increasing the clock frequency and doubling the number of ALUs, nVIDIA provided GeForce4 Ti with approximately three times the vertex shading capability of GeForce3, and easily eliminated Radeon 8500.

On March 13, 2002, at CeBIT 2002, PowerVR Technologies of Imagination Technologies announced KyroII SE, the core code name STG4800. According to published information, compared with Kyro II, its core and memory frequency have been increased to 200Mhz, and EnT&L was created. It has achieved the performance of GeForce2 GTS and the same period GeForce4 MX 420.Only Imagination’s Vivid! XS Elite and Hercules’ 3D Prophet 4800 were announced to use KyroII SE chip graphics cards, and they were not sold.Hercules sent out some boxed 3D Prophet 4800 graphics cards for evaluation. The core and video memory frequency is 200Mhz by default.The graphics card core and memory frequency of this 3D Prophet 4800 engineering sample (Chip date and PCB date is 0216 weeks) is 175Mhz by default.It can be seen that Kyro II SE is the overclocked version of Kyro II, but it has been simply revised with software T&L support.On the same day and at the same place, PowerVR Technologies also demonstrated the PowerVR MBX core for embedded graphics applications. It is easy to understand that the Kyro II SE project was abandoned, and the Kyro III project was suspended. The main reason was that in the GPU competition, PowerVR Technologies could not solve the hardware T&L for a while, so it was unable to gain a foothold and had to focus on the handheld graphics market.

On May 14, 2002, Matrox released its first generation GPU-Parhelia 512. Although it got rid of the embarrassing situation of using G450 and G550 without hardware T&L against the GeForce series. However, the Parhelia 512 graphics card, which was introduced to the market after a long R&D process, its 3D performance is not great, only comparable to GeForce4 Ti4200. Matrox had to give up support for 3D games, quit the GPU hegemony, and became a professional 2D graphics card manufacturer.

On June 3, 2002 (week 0223), S3 merged into VIA and released the first generation GPU: Savage XP. Savage XP is fundamentally "only" a revised version of Savage2000. Although it supports hardware T&L, its performance is still at a low level, only at the Geforce256 level. Savage XP, also known as Alpha Chrome, is the first of VIA's Chrome product line, with a small number of applications on the mobile platform.

On March 12, 2002, SiS announced the Xabre series of graphics cards, namely Xabre 80, Xabre 200, Xabre 400, and the updated Xabre 600 with higher frequency. The performance of Xabre series graphics cards is not fully utilized due to driver compatibility issues. The performance of Xabre 400 graphics cards is comparable to that of GeForce4 MX440. The highlight is the first graphics card that supports AGP 8X.

In April 2002, at the WinHEC conference, Trident announced the development of XP4 graphics cards. The XP4 prototype card was tested in August and the result was only 60% of the GeForce4 Ti 4200. On January 24, 2003, Trident said that because UMC's .13um process capacity was too low, the mass production of the XP4 graphics chip was postponed. In fact, Trident is already in trouble and is seeking to sell the graphics department to SiS. As a result, the XP4 graphics card has not been sold. The mobile version of Cyber XP4 was only sold after Trident sold. XP5 is XP4 that supports AGP 8x, and the development is almost completed in April, while the development of XP8 that supports DirectX 9 has been discontinued.

On July 18, 2002, ATi released the Radeon 9700 PRO (R300 series) graphics card. It is the world's first display chip that fully supports DirectX 9. The floating-point high-precision and high-performance texture effects brought by DirectX 9.0 are very shocking to the dramatic changes in the game screen. It allowed ATi to outperform nVIDIA's flagship graphics card GeForce4 Ti4600 in performance for the first time in the GPU competition since 1999 by more than 50%. Since 2002, ATi began to fight against nVIDIA, becoming the two dominant players in the graphics card market.

GeForce4 series products are mainly divided into high-end Ti, low-end MX, and GeForce4 Go for mobile computers. There is also a PCX 4300 that supports the PCI-E interface through the HSI bridge chip. The professional version has the Quadro4 series.
